Laguna Laundry is a Laundry establishment in Langebaan, Western Cape, South Africa
Laguna Laundry: Laundry Services in Langebaan, Western Cape
Laguna Laundry is a family‑owned and managed operation serving Langebaan and the surrounding West Coast communities, with additional facilities in Saldanha and Club Mykonos. The business emphasises a trustworthy, friendly and reliable service, underpinned by a Level 1 BEE accreditation. The organisation positions itself as “more than just laundry,” offering both convenience and customised attention to individual customer needs.
The core offering includes a comprehensive range of laundry services designed for domestic use, guest houses and business clients. The primary services listed are Wash & Dry, an ironing service, handling of overalls and industrial workwear, and cleaning of linen, curtains and loose upholstery. Each service is framed around efficiency and care, with references to same‑day turnaround for drop‑offs and competitive pricing for large or specialised items.
For customers looking to manage their own laundry, Laguna Laundry provides a self‑service option at Club Mykonos, Langebaan. The self‑service facility operates on a coin‑operated model and is available 24 hours a day, seven days a week, including public holidays. This convenience is complemented by the option to drop off and collect for standard servicing at the main site or the Club Mykonos location, offering flexibility for varied schedules.
Industrial and commercial clients are explicitly supported through a dedicated depot in Nordyk Park, Saldanha, which handles overalls and workwear. The service includes a convenient collection and delivery arrangement for businesses located within the Saldanha Industrial area, reflecting the company’s aim to accommodate project‑based needs and contractor schedules.
Operational hours are clearly defined across sites. The Langebaan/Club Mykonos locations typically operate from 8:00 to 18:00 on weekdays, with shorter hours on Saturdays and Sundays. The Club Mykonos site specifically offers drop‑and‑collect services on weekdays, while the self‑service facility remains accessible around the clock. The Saldanha industrial depot adheres to business hours for the collection and delivery service, enabling regular scheduling for commercial clients.

Typical job types fall into several broad categories. Domestic clients frequently bring in everyday textiles such as clothing, bedding and household textiles for wash and dry, ironing, and folding. For commercial or industrial needs, the emphasis is on linen and towels, as well as the cleaning of overalls and specialised workwear, with a service model that can include collection and delivery to business premises. Additionally, the self‑service facility at Club Mykonos provides an option for customers who prefer to manage their own laundry at any time.
Requests and service flow are described in practical terms. Drop‑off by 12:00 is noted as a trigger for same‑day service, underscoring Laguna Laundry’s efficiency‑driven approach. For industrial clients, arrangements can be made for convenient collection and delivery within the relevant industrial zones. Langebaan, a coastal town on the Cape West coast, presents a range of laundry options designed to suit both residents and visitors. Local laundry service providers typically offer a combination of domestic washing, drying and ironing, as well as specialised cleaning for fabrics and events. The emphasis is on reliable turnaround, careful handling of garments and practical pricing structures, with services tailored to the town’s maritime climate and seasonal tourism demands.
Typical services delivered by laundry businesses in Langebaan include standard washing and drying, garment ironing, and folding. Many operations also provide washing of delicate fabrics, such as silk or wool, using appropriate detergents and temperatures. Ironing services are commonly offered as either a separate job or bundled with washing and drying, producing neatly pressed clothing ready for wear. For larger items, such as duvets, bedspreads or towels, dedicated wash cycles and longer drying times are often used to ensure thorough cleaning and fabric care.
Dry cleaning and specialist cleaning are usually available through selected providers, particularly for items requiring solvent-based processes, formalwear, or upholstery fabrics. While the exact methods may vary, customers can typically expect careful handling, clear guidance on suitable fabrics, and modest turnaround times. Some outlets extend the offering to include minor alterations, stitching, or repairs as a convenience for clients who need a quick fix alongside laundry needs.
In Langebaan, as in many coastal communities, convenience and flexibility are valued. A number of laundry operations provide a drop-off and collection service, allowing clients to leave garments at a shop or have them picked up from a home or accommodation address. Depending on demand and item volume, same-day or next-day service is commonly advertised, subject to the items’ condition and the cleaning method required. Clear pricing is usually presented for standard loads, special items, and any premium services such as stain treatment or express handling.
Practical considerations for customers include the care labels on garments, the restriction of certain fabrics to specific washing cycles, and the need to separate heavily soiled items or items with delicate embellishments. Customers are often advised to request stain pre-treatment options where appropriate and to communicate any sensitivities to detergents or fabric softeners. Given the town’s proximity to beaches and outdoor activities, many households bring items such as swimwear and towels to laundry services for proper sanitisation and odour control, particularly after extended outdoor use.
Understanding how laundry services normally operate can help visitors and residents alike. A typical workflow begins with customers dropping off or requesting a collection, followed by item sorting and appropriate treatment based on fabric type and user instructions. The items are washed with suitable detergents, dried, and finished by ironing or folding. Special requests, such as crease-free presentation or extra rinse cycles, are usually accommodated where feasible. Upon completion, items are returned in a ready-to-wear condition, with any notes about care or future maintenance communicated to the customer.
